What’s Driving the Recent Ethereum ETF Surge?

On August 20, the U. S. spot Ethereum exchange-traded fund (ETF) attracted over $220 million in new investments. This influx of capital signals renewed interest in Ethereum as the cryptocurrency gears up for another potential breakout. The Ethereum ETF experienced net inflows of approximately $219 million, marking its fourth consecutive day of growth. BlackRock's ETHA ETF played a pivotal role in this surge, leading the demand for Ethereum investments.

Ethereum has been in the financial spotlight, largely due to the increasing popularity of its ETFs. The significant inflow of capital reflects growing confidence among investors in Ethereum’s future performance. Analysts suggest that institutional interest is a key factor behind this trend. The recent inflows indicate a shift in market sentiment, as many see Ethereum as a viable asset for long-term growth.

The positive momentum comes as Ethereum has reclaimed key price levels, enhancing its appeal. Investors are closely watching market trends, as the cryptocurrency aims to break through previous resistance levels. The combination of institutional investment and favorable market conditions may set the stage for Ethereum to reach new heights.

What is an Ethereum ETF? An Ethereum ETF allows investors to buy shares that represent ownership of Ethereum without directly holding the cryptocurrency. This provides exposure to Ethereum's price movements while simplifying the investment process.

Why are institutional investors interested in Ethereum? Institutional investors see Ethereum as a promising asset due to its growing adoption and potential use cases, particularly in decentralized finance (DeFi) and smart contracts. This interest can drive significant capital inflows into the market.
